Horse Creek
Horse Creek is a stream in Walker, Alabama. Horse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Pleasant Grove, as well as near Hilliard.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Oakman is a town in Walker County, Alabama, United States. At the 2020 census the population was 771, down from 789 in 2010. Initially named Day Gap, it was renamed Oakman and incorporated in 1895. Oakman is situated 6 miles south of Horse Creek.
